Medica Group currently offers two primary services to hospital radiology departments to meet demand and supply imbalance in urgent and non urgent settings: NightHawk and Elective (previously Routine) which includes cross-sectional (CT/MR) and plain film (PF) examinations. These services provide hospital radiology departments, amongst other benefits, the ability to manage their workflow more efficiently and provide rapid access to specialist Consultant Radiologists, which may not be available to that hospital at the relevant time or at all.
NightHawk
Out of hours emergency reporting service which is focused on improved patient outcomes and short turnaround times, which average 25 minutes and typically provides reporting on CT scans.
Elective
Both for less urgent daytime reporting, as well as access to expertise in particular sub-specialisms. Elective covers a combination of CT and MR scans (both forms of cross-sectional scan) and Plain Film examinations typically with a 48 hour turnaround time.

History
Medica Group was established in January 2004. In 2007, Nuffield Health acquired 50 per cent. of the Group, acquiring further stakes in 2011 and in 2013 before selling a majority shareholding to CBPE in a management buy-out in May 2013. The Company became a listed business in 2017, entering the London Stock Exchange in March of that year.
As a rapidly growing business, Medica Group has significantly developed the operational aspects of its business over recent years. In 2012, the Group achieved ISO 9001, ISO 27001 and CQC accreditations. In 2014, the Group relocated its Sussex head office from Battle to Hastings to help facilitate its growth. In the same year, the Group established its Clinical Advisory Group, as well as bringing in-house the out of hours call-handling team to provide greater control over the NightHawk process.
The Group has established its own software development department and has expanded its physical locations by opening reporting centres globally. Medica Group has also achieved accreditation from the The Quality Standard for Imaging Scheme (formerly “ISAS”), which is the only nationally recognised accreditation scheme for the diagnostic imaging services sector in the UK and is licensed by both the Royal College of Radiologists and the Society of Radiographers.
